您现在的位置是: 首页 - 农业资讯 - 如何在ASP.NET中创建第一个实例 农业资讯
如何在ASP.NET中创建第一个实例
2025-04-13 【农业资讯】 0人已围观
简介ASP.NET是一个开源的Web应用框架,由微软开发,它允许开发人员使用C#、VB.NET等多种编程语言来构建动态网页。这个教程将指导你完成在ASP.NET中创建第一个实例的步骤。 安装Visual Studio 首先,你需要安装Visual Studio,这是Microsoft官方提供的一款集成开发环境(IDE),用于开发和调试各种类型的应用程序,包括ASP.NET项目
ASP.NET是一个开源的Web应用框架,由微软开发,它允许开发人员使用C#、VB.NET等多种编程语言来构建动态网页。这个教程将指导你完成在ASP.NET中创建第一个实例的步骤。
安装Visual Studio
首先,你需要安装Visual Studio,这是Microsoft官方提供的一款集成开发环境(IDE),用于开发和调试各种类型的应用程序,包括ASP.NET项目。在安装过程中选择“个人”版本,因为它足以满足我们学习和实验需求。
创建新的ASP.NET项目
打开Visual Studio,点击菜单栏上的“文件”->“新建”->“项目”,然后在弹出的对话框中选择“.NET Core”下的“ASP.NET Core Web Application”。
选择模板
在下一步骤中,你会看到几个不同类型的模板供你选择。对于初学者来说,“Web Application(Model-View-Controller)”是一个很好的起点,它包含了MVC架构,即模型、视图和控制器,这是一种常用的软件设计模式。
配置项目设置
配置好你的新项目后,给你的项目命名,比如叫做“MyFirstAspNetApp”。确保选项卡中的框架是最新版本的.Net Core SDK。如果没有,请下载并安装相应版本。
设计用户界面
接下来,我们要为我们的网站添加一些基本内容。右键点击解决方案资源管理器中的"Pages"文件夹,选择"添加" -> "新建页面...",然后输入名称例如:"Index.cshtml"并确认。
添加HTML结构
打开刚刚创建的Index.cshtml文件,在其中添加以下HTML代码: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>My First ASP.NET App</title>
</head>
<body>
<h1>Welcome to My First ASP.NET App</h1>
<p>This is my first ASP.net application.</p>
</body>
</html>
保存更改,并刷新浏览器查看结果。你应该能看到简单但美观的欢迎界面了!
编写服务器端逻辑
现在,让我们向前端增加一些交互性。在Index.cshtml上方找到<section>标签,并删除其内容,然后用以下代码替换它:
@{
var name = "World";
}
<h2>Hello @name!</h2>
<button type="button">Click me!</button>
<script src="_framework/blazor.server.js"></script>
这里,我们引入了Blazor Server-side库,该库使得可以从客户端直接调用服务器端方法,从而实现动态更新UI。这段代码定义了一个变量name并传递给模板字符串,以便生成动态文本。此外,还有一个按钮,当被点击时不会发生任何实际操作,但这展示了如何通过事件处理程序与用户交互。
运行应用程序
最后,要运行你的应用程序,只需点击工具栏上的绿色播放按钮或者按F5键即可。在浏览器窗口中,你将看到你之前编写过的一个简单页面,但是现在,当你按下按钮时,你会注意到页面没有反应。这是因为目前还没有为按钮绑定任何事件处理函数或服务器端逻辑来响应该事件。但不要担心,这只是未来学习阶段的一部分,而不是当前教程结束的地方。
结语:
恭喜!您已经成功地设置好了您的第一个asp.net核心web应用!虽然这是个基础开始,但您已经掌握了一些关键概念,如建立新的项目、设计用户界面以及运行app。从这里出发,您可以探索更多高级功能,如数据库连接、路由配置以及安全性等方面。如果您想进一步深化知识,可以考虑研究Blazor组件库,以及其他扩展技术栈如Entity FrameworkCore进行CRUD操作等。继续保持好奇心,不断尝试不同的技术挑战吧!